Ticket regarding the shuttle-bus gate at the Fernhollow campus south entrance. The motor on the pedestrian side has been repaired, but the badge reader will remain offline until the Veltane contractor returns next week. In the meantime, team assistants escorting visitors to the shuttle stop should use the keypad on the left-hand post rather than tailgating through the vehicle barrier, which triggers an alarm. Please brief any new starters on this. To open the pedestrian gate, enter the code below.

staff pass of kawip-hawef = bdg-QLP-2

## Support

The Inkrelay spooler microservice is maintained by the Print Platform team at Corvalett. As a contractor, please do not open issues directly against the production tracker; instead, document the symptom, affected queue, and approximate timestamp, and include relevant log lines from the `inkrelay-worker` pods. Response times are typically one business day, faster for print-blocking incidents. For code questions, start with the architecture notes in `/docs`. For everything else, write to the maintainers at the address below.

alerts address for bajop-yahog: istwyn@lumiclabs.internal

Subject: Tilehound cut-over — done

Hey all, quick summary for the sync: we finished moving the map-tile prefetcher onto the new Tilehound workers last night. Cut-over took about forty minutes, no dropped tiles, and cache hit rate actually ticked up once the warmers caught on. One hiccup: the old prefetch schedule lingered for an hour before we flushed it. Everything's now driven from the consolidated config rather than per-region overrides. For reference, the values we went live with are below.

settings of bafof-fajog:
[aldix]
port = 9300
region = north-3
host = aldix.kelvilabs.example
team = istath
timeout_ms = 1500
retries = 8

Before executing the migration, confirm that both the expand and contract phases have been reviewed and that the application is running a version compatible with the intermediate schema. Apply the expand migration first, verify replication lag stays under two seconds, then roll the application pods gradually. Do not run the contract phase until all traffic confirms the new code paths. Migration bundles are signed artifacts; the runner will refuse unsigned packages. Verify the bundle signature using the release signing key below.

signing key of kadug-tafog = bky13_cnE4sBjc1HDyq